3 Before first use
Remove all packaging materials from the induction
cooker.
Preparing for use
1 Place the appliance on a dry, stable and level
surface.
2 Make sure there is at least 10cm free space around
the appliance to prevent overheating.
3 Always place the cookware on the cooking zone
during cooking.
4 Make sure you use cookware of the correct types
and sizes (see the table below).
Recommended types and sizes of
cookware
Material Cookware with a bottom made of iron or
magnetic stainless steel
Shape Cookware with a at bottom
Size Cookware with a bottom diameter of 12-
23cm, depending on the cooking mode
4 Using the induction cooker
There are ten cooking modes: Congee ( ), Saute
( ), Steam/Stew ( ), Roast ( ), Soup ( ), Milk ( ),
Slow Cook ( ), Fry ( ), Water ( ) and Hot Pot ( ).
1 Follow the steps in “Preparing for use”.
2 Press the On/O button ( ), the On/O indicator
lights up.
3 Press the cooking buttons or the Menu button
to choose the desired cooking mode. The
corresponding indicator lights up and the
induction cooker starts working in the selected
mode.
4 When the cooking is nished, press the On/O
button ( ) to switch o the appliance.
5 Unplug the induction cooker after the fan stops
working.
Note
During cooking, you can change the power level by
pressing the Increase (
) or Decrease ( ) button.
In Water ( ), Soup ( ), Steam/Stew ( ), Congee ( )
and Milk (
) modes, the cooking power automatically
changes for better cooking result.
